I have not been to Puamana, but DO have a Maui Revealed book and can tell you that they rate the place a 'Solid Gold Value'and 'an easy place to recommend'. They describe it as 'relaxed, soothing and lovely', with 'nicely furnished' units. Reportedly a 5 night minimum.
In reference to the beach the book states that it is a 'walking beach, not good for swimming because it's reefy and cloudy'. Hope this helps. I do recommend you get the book. Loads of info! |

ntgeek, our family (two girls, 13 and 10) stayed in Elua 101 for 5 days in June. We walked in and felt it to be quite comfortably suited for us. There is brand new furniture, carpeting and lovely art throughout. The kitchen area is pretty basic, but has everything you'd need for cooking meals. There is free wireless internet and phone use, even to the mainland. The patio area is large and offers a distant view of the ocean. You'll find everything you need to enjoy time there, plenty of lounge chairs and tables, a brand new gas grill and a lovely little garden area, (they are ground level.) The bedrooms are well appointed, both with new furniture and lovely linens, however we found the a/c in the master not adequate for our needs. The bathrooms were a bit dated but it didn't really bother us. There are plenty of beach items; umbrellas, chairs, beach towels, mats, sand toys... The lower pool and beach are a bit of a walk so we loaded up the car and found parking closer, which took us only a minute or two. The lower pool is steps from the beach. This pool is lovely, just off the beach and eventhough it is small, it never seemed overly crowded. This pool has a covered area for dining, with it's own kitchen and barbecue. The fridge was very handy to keep food and drinks cold and available while at the pool/beach. The pool is small but we never felt crowded. The Elua complex is beautiful and very well taken care of. If you are unfamiliar with the beach in this area, it's wonderful! The only draw back to condo 101 was the constant traffic noise. Their condo backs to the lower Wailea highway, and you cannot escape from it, even with the doors closed. So if that is not an issue, I think you would enjoy your stay. Would we stay at Elua again, YES. Would we use 101 again? Unfortunately not, only because of the noise. I really hopes this info helps. Enjoy your trip!
